Further, as informed earlier, Friday, March 20,2020 is the Record Date to determine the name(s) of the equity shareholder(s), who shall be entitled to receive payment towards Interim Dividend of the Company for the financial year 2019-20. The said interim Dividend is proposed to be paid from March 26,2020 onwards. Corporate actions: Dividend history for Ashok Leyland Ltd. Ashok Leyland Ltd. has declared 18 dividends since June 18, 2001. In the past 12 months, Ashok Leyland Ltd. has declared an equity dividend amounting to Rs 3.10 per share. At the current share price of Rs 63.25, this results in a dividend yield of 4.9%. Ashok Leyland Limited, together with its subsidiaries, manufactures and sells commercial vehicles in India and internationally. The company offers city, inter-city, school and college, staff, tourist, stage carrier, and airport buses; haulage, mining and construction, and distribution trucks, as well as tractors; light and small commercial vehicles, goods carriers, and passenger vehicles; and
